Orangeries, typically considered as classic marvels of architecture, have actually been a sign of splendour and elegance for centuries. Originally created as winter quarters for citrus trees, these gorgeous glass structures have actually evolved into versatile areas best for entertaining, relaxation, and even working from home. How long does an orangery remodelling usually take?
Normally, the whole procedure can take anywhere from a number of months to over a year, depending on the extent of the remodelling and essential approvals.
2. How much does it cost to refurbish an orangery?
Expenses can vary significantly based on size, structural condition, products, and design options. On average, renovations can vary from ₤ 50,000 to over ₤ 200,000.
3. Can I use an orangery year-round?
Yes, with the ideal insulation, heating, and cooling systems, orangeries can be comfortable and usable throughout the year. Think about double-glazed glass for ideal temperature level control.
4. Do I require preparing authorization to remodel an orangery?
In many cases, yes, particularly if the orangery is a listed building or falls under conservation guidelines. Constantly examine with local authorities before starting restorations.
